DingDongWillyWong
Nathan
United Kingdom (Great Britain)
Currently Offline
Artwork Showcase
.
Recent Activity
473 hrs on record
last played on Jan 7
71 hrs on record
last played on Dec 7, 2025
0.2 hrs on record
last played on Nov 20, 2025